ABSTRACT

A feminist theory that is derived from the experiences of those theorizing requires the presence of women of color as generators of theory as subjects rather than objects. The focus on "difference" in psychology has walked into feminist theory unanalyzed; therefore, difference can be seen as natural and unchangeable and/or as signifying deficiency. Some efforts by feminist therapy theorists, for example those of the Feminist Therapy Institute and the recent Women of Color Institute of the Association for Women in Psychology raise the hopes about a new understanding and opening among white feminists. An important aspect of language usage for women of color is its connection with self-esteem and identity development. For women who speak more than one language, there is yet another component in the development of personality and the expression of psychopathology. Women of color are essential partners in the development of feminist psychology and feminist therapy.
